eslint - Optional chaining error with vscode

I am seeing a a red underline when I'm using an optional chain, but the code runs fine as I am on node 14

Here's my setup:

node 14.1.0
eslint "^6.8.0"

.eslintrc.js

module.exports = {
    "env": {
        "node": true
    },
    "extends": [
        "eslint:recommended",
    ],
    "parserOptions": {
        "sourceType": "module",
        "ecmaVersion": 2020
    },
    "rules": {
    },
}
